Literature summary for 2.7.7.48 extracted from

  • Gordon,C.J.; Tchesnokov,E.P.; Woolner, E.; Perry, J.K.; Feng,J.Y.; Porter, D.P.; Götte, M.
    Remdesivir is a direct-acting antiviral that inhibits RNA-dependent RNA polymerase from severe acute respiratory syndrome coronavirus 2 with high potency (2020), J. Biol. Chem., 295, 6785-6797 .
    View publication on PubMedView publication on EuropePMC

Inhibitors

Inhibitors Comment Organism Structure
remdesivir triphosphate the inhibitor causes a delayed chain termination at position i+3 Human respiratory syncytial virus A
remdesivir triphosphate the inhibitor causes a delayed chain termination at position i+3 Severe acute respiratory syndrome coronavirus 2
